Defensive itemization against mixed damage?

Hi guys I would like to know how to itemize defensively against champions going both magic damage and physical damage. For example, On Hit Teemo and Bruiser Fizz. My thought is that their magic damage from abilities does more early, so rush mr. Yet when I do that I am told to rush armor. What to do and why? And this si assuming I need to do so, so advice like "win lane so he can't get enough cs to get items", just no.
